在当今互联网时代,网站速度是衡量一个网站用户体验的重要指标。一个加载缓慢的网站不仅会流失访客,还会影响搜索引擎的排名。因此,优化网站速度对于提升用户体验和搜索引擎优化(SEO)至关重要。本文将揭秘如何利用jQuery轻松提升页面加载速度,让你的网页飞起来!
jQuery简介
jQuery是一个快速、小型且功能丰富的JavaScript库。它简化了HTML文档遍历、事件处理、动画和Ajax操作。通过使用jQuery,我们可以轻松实现许多原本复杂的JavaScript功能。
网站速度优化的重要性
- 用户体验:一个快速加载的网站可以提供更好的用户体验,减少用户等待时间,提高用户满意度。
- 搜索引擎优化:搜索引擎如Google、Bing等会优先考虑加载速度快的网站,因为它们认为这样的网站可以提供更好的用户体验。
- 降低运营成本:快速加载的网站可以减少服务器负载,降低带宽成本。
利用jQuery提升页面加载速度的方法
1. 减少HTTP请求
HTTP请求是导致页面加载缓慢的主要原因之一。以下是一些减少HTTP请求的方法:
- 合并CSS和JavaScript文件:将多个CSS和JavaScript文件合并成一个文件,减少HTTP请求次数。
- 使用CSS精灵:将多个图片合并成一个,减少图片加载次数。
- 使用CSS和JavaScript压缩工具:压缩CSS和JavaScript文件,减少文件大小。
2. 使用缓存
缓存可以将静态资源存储在用户的本地,从而减少服务器请求次数。以下是一些实现缓存的方法:
- 使用浏览器缓存:通过设置HTTP缓存头,让浏览器缓存静态资源。
- 使用CDN(内容分发网络):CDN可以将静态资源缓存到全球多个节点,减少服务器负载。
3. 使用jQuery实现懒加载
懒加载是一种优化网页加载速度的技术,它可以将非关键资源延迟加载。以下是一些使用jQuery实现懒加载的方法:
- 图片懒加载:当图片进入可视区域时,才加载图片。
- 内容懒加载:当用户滚动到页面底部时,再加载下一页内容。
4. 使用jQuery优化动画
动画是网站中常见的元素,但过度的动画会降低页面加载速度。以下是一些使用jQuery优化动画的方法:
- 使用CSS3动画:CSS3动画比jQuery动画更快,因为它不需要JavaScript。
- 使用CSS3的
transform属性:transform属性可以优化动画性能,因为它不会引起页面重排和重绘。
5. 使用jQuery实现Ajax
Ajax是一种在不重新加载页面的情况下与服务器交换数据的 technique。以下是一些使用jQuery实现Ajax的方法:
- 使用Ajax获取数据:将数据加载到页面中,而不是重新加载整个页面。
- 使用Ajax实现分页:当用户滚动到页面底部时,再加载下一页内容。
总结
通过以上方法,我们可以利用jQuery轻松提升页面加载速度,让你的网页飞起来!优化网站速度不仅可以提升用户体验,还可以提高搜索引擎排名,降低运营成本。希望本文对你有所帮助!
